Even Obama proposes cutting FICA taxes, the only source for SocSec. You cut the funding in half but continue benefits? That isn't a Ponzi scheme? If Social Security is not a ponzi scheme then set Madoff free. He went to prison because he didn't find enough 'new investors'. Compare Social Security.
((Reading: The comment of Rick Perry is no way original. Jonathan Last identified News Week Paul Samuelson as the first to use 'Ponzi Scheme'.))
((Reading on: In 1978, Samuelson followed up on his first article.))
((Reading on: [many others writing] Social Security is like a chain-letter. WSJ said Social Security is a Ponzi Scheme. Michael Barone called it a ponzi scheme, impossible to collect without massive tax increases. In 1994, Jeff Jacobi said, "Not being in politics, I can call it a ponzi scheme." Etc. Robert Shapiro, Liberal, "As it is currently structured, a ponzi scheme". Newsweek Jonathan Alter, "willing to say it is a Ponzi Scheme".)) Should I go on?
(Reading on: Only a Grinch could grumble but only a Fool would not ask about this Ponzi Scheme. Senator Simpson talked about the Ponzi Scheme. 1996 Slate wrote, "From Ponzi Scheme to Shell Game"; Etc; Bla-bla-bla-bla-blah.)) To harp on Perry over this is to take the Leftist Liberal side.
